FHI 360 is a nonprofit human development organization dedicated to improving lives in lasting ways by advancing integrated, locally driven solutions. Our staff includes experts in health, education, nutrition, environment, economic development, civil society, gender, youth, research and technology — creating a unique mix of capabilities to address today’s interrelated development challenges. FHI 360 serves more than 70 countries and all U.S. states and territories. We are currently seeking qualified candidates for the position of: Regional Financial Analyst

Job Summary / Responsibilities
- The role will work closely with the Director Enterprise Services and country program team to support the monthly forecast process including data collection and consolidation, report generation. The Analyst will work with program teams to review the work plans and how the impact the monthly projected burn rates. The analyst will analyze individual line items and how they relate to the overall programmatic work plans.
- Support oversight and reporting Business Unit level on key indicators reported monthly/ quarterly to HQ.
- Develop and monitor performance standards and support corrective action / capacity development
- Provide budgeting support for proposal budgets and review operational budgets and modifications
- Analysis and financial commentary on pipeline reports and burn rates to help assure FHI 360 that we are tracking financial obligations to sub partners and detailed monitoring of budgets to assure compliance with funder terms and conditions. The role will also entail preparing budget statues and projection reports in collaboration with the Director Enterprise Services, using detailed forecasts and analysis of expenditure, prior cost information and planned actions and funds

Qualifications
- BS/BA in Accounting or Finance or related field and 3-5 years combined experience in accounting / budgeting management or MS/MA/MBA with 3 -5 years combined experience in accounting/ budgeting management
- Knowledge of U.S Government grants, contracting and auditing standards as they apply to effective management of multi-year funds
- Knowledge of generally accepted accounting, budgeting and fiscal control theory and practices
- Budget development skills with multi funding sources and general ledger skills
- Revelant software skills to include automated accounting software and database spreadsheet and Management Information Systems
- Work independently with initiative to manage high volume work flow, may structure work of staff members
